When you have diabetes, your body doesn't make enough insulin, can't use it as well as it … WebPatients receiving lactated Ringer's and normal saline remained normoglycaemic throughout the study period. Patients receiving dextrose saline had significantly elevated plasma glucose 15 minutes after completion of infusion (11.1 (9.9-12.2, 95% CI) mmol/l). WebIf surgery is in the morning. 2 1/2 hours before surgery (~6.00 a.m.) a BGL should be performed. If BGL is below 8.0 mmol/L, the child should be given a drink of lemonade or other palatable sugar-containing clear fluid (10% sugar). The amount given should be between 5 and 10 mL/kg body weight with a maximum of 200 mL.
